Gulfgate Pine Valley, Houston, TX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Gulfgate Pine Valley?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gulfgate Pine Valley Studio Apartments | $610 | $610 | $610 |
| Gulfgate Pine Valley 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,038 | $689 | $1,600 |
| Gulfgate Pine Valley 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,267 | $899 | $1,550 |
| Gulfgate Pine Valley 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,469 | $1,030 | $1,860 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Gulfgate Pine Valley
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Gulfgate Pine Valley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Gulfgate Pine Valley ranges from $689 to $1,600 with an average monthly rent of $1,038.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Gulfgate Pine Valley c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Gulfgate Pine Valley range from $899 to $1,550.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,267.
How expensive are Gulfgate Pine Valley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 24 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Gulfgate Pine Valley on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,030 to $1,860 - averaging $1,469 for the location.
